: Using unauthorized third-party tools typically voids any active manufacturer warranty. Critical Maintenance Note
Resetting the counter only clears the software error; it does
physically clean the ink pads. If you reset the counter multiple times without physically replacing or cleaning the maintenance pads, excess waste ink may eventually overflow and damage the internal components of your printer.
